Clear and dry in South Lake Tahoe Sunday through Thursday

Light snow, rain, wind, clouds and rainbows were all part of the weather day Saturday in South Lake Tahoe. The weather front is on it's way out, leaving a week of sunny and clear skies and mild temperatures.
Approximately .44" of rain fell at lake level.
The week's forecast according to weather.gov:
Sunday - Mostly sunny, with a high near 44. West wind around 5 mph becoming northeast in the morning. Overnight, mostly clear, with a low around 21. East wind around 5 mph.
Monday - Mostly sunny, with a high near 49. East wind around 5 mph. In the evening, Mostly clear, with a low around 25. East wind around 5 mph becoming calm.
Tuesday - Clear with a high of 56 and a low of 26.
Wednesday - Clear to partly cloudy with a high of 57 and a low of 28.
Thursday - Thanksgiving will be mostly sunny with a low of 58. Overnight, partly cloudy skies with a low of 28.
Friday - Mostly sunny, with a high near 53. Slight chance of rain with a low of 28 in the evening.
Saturday's forecast differs between the weather forecasters. Weather.gov calls for mostly sunny with a high of 50. Accuweater.com has light snow in the forecast with a high of 47 and a low of 27.
